What is the Florida Commercial Photography Permit?
The Florida Commercial Photography Permit is an official authorization required for individuals and companies wishing to conduct commercial photography or filming within Florida state parks. This permit is issued by the relevant park authority and serves to ensure compliance with state regulations and protect natural resources.
The jurisdictions covered by this permit include all Florida state parks, which offer a variety of scenic locations ideal for commercial projects. Failure to obtain this permit may result in legal penalties and restrictions.

Who Needs the Florida Commercial Photography Permit?
The Florida Commercial Photography Permit is mandatory for a variety of individuals and organizations. This includes freelance photographers, production companies, and entities producing commercial content such as TV programs and corporate events.
In specific cases like TV program filming in Florida, obtaining this permit is essential to adhere to local regulations and to ensure a smooth filming process.

Submission Methods and Delivery of the Florida Commercial Photography Permit
There are multiple methods available for submitting the completed permit application. Applicants can choose to file their applications online or submit a physical copy through mail. It is essential to check specific submission guidelines provided by the park authority.
The timeline for processing applications may vary, so it’s advisable to submit well in advance of the intended shooting dates.
Fees and Payment Methods for the Florida Commercial Photography Permit
Acquiring the Florida Commercial Photography Permit involves certain fees, which can vary by park and type of photography. Acceptable forms of payment typically include checks or online payment methods.
Some fee waivers may be available under specific conditions, such as non-profit productions or educational projects.
